Insightful Q&A Section

  1. Question: What’s the secret to preventing biryani from becoming mushy?

    Answer: The key is to use the right type of rice (basmati is best) and to avoid overcooking it. Rinse the rice thoroughly before cooking to remove excess starch, and use a rice-to-water ratio that is slightly less than usual. Fluff the rice gently with a fork after cooking to separate the grains.

  2. Question: How can I add more depth of flavour to my biryani?

    Answer: Experiment with different types of aromatics, such as saffron, rose water, or kewra water. You can also add a small amount of ghee or butter to the rice for added richness. Marinating the meat or vegetables overnight will also enhance their flavour.

  3. Question: What are some common mistakes to avoid when making biryani?

    Answer: Overcooking the rice, using too much water, and not layering the ingredients properly are all common mistakes. Be sure to follow the recipe carefully and pay attention to the cooking times.

  4. Question: Can I make biryani in a slow cooker?

    Answer: Yes, you can make biryani in a slow cooker, but you will need to adjust the cooking time and liquid ratio accordingly. It’s best to layer the ingredients in the slow cooker and cook on low for several hours.

  5. Question: How can I make my biryani spicier?

    Answer: Add more chili powder, green chilies, or red chili flakes to the masala. You can also use a spicier variety of chili pepper. Be sure to taste the biryani as it cooks and adjust the spice level to your liking.

  6. Question: What are some good vegetarian options for biryani?

    Answer: Paneer (Indian cheese), vegetables like cauliflower, potatoes, carrots, and peas, or mushrooms are all excellent vegetarian options for biryani. You can also use lentils or chickpeas for added protein.

  7. Question: How long does biryani last in the refrigerator?

    Answer: Biryani can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days. Be sure to store it in an airtight container to prevent it from drying out.

  8. Question: Can I freeze biryani?

    Answer: Yes, you can freeze biryani, but the texture of the rice may change slightly. It’s best to freeze it in individual portions for easy thawing. Thaw the biryani in the refrigerator overnight before reheating.

  9. Question: What are some traditional accompaniments for biryani?

    Answer: Raita (yogurt dip), salad, and papadums (crispy lentil wafers) are all traditional accompaniments for biryani.

  10. Question: How can I achieve that smoky flavour in my biryani?

    Answer: You can use the ‘dhungar’ method. Place a small steel bowl with a burning charcoal piece on top of the cooked biryani, pour a spoon of ghee over the charcoal and cover the lid tightly. This will infuse the smoky flavour.
